Herath shot to prominence against Australia in 1999
with a 'mystery' ball. An orthodox left-arm spinner who broke into
the side after an impressive A tour to England, he deceived the
Australians in the first few matches with a delivery that darted the
other way. After that series he has hovered on the fringes of the
Test squad for a while, regularly playing for the A team, before
being recalled for the third Test against Australia in Colombo. He
didn't get a game on the tour to Australia, but in Pakistan in
2004-05, he showed plenty of signs of his talent - bowling slowly
through the air, getting it to flight, grip and turn, he took 11
wickets in two Tests. One among a long line of Sri Lankan slow
bowlers, Herath could well be Muttiah Muralitharan's long-term spin
partner.
